AFSOC commander visits Cannon Airmen

Lt. Gen. Jim Slife, Air Force Special Operations Command commander, and Chief Master Sgt. Cory Olson, AFSOC command chief, receive a briefing on the capabilities of the air traffic control tower at Melrose Air Force Range, N.M., from Steve Coffin, 27th Special Operations Air Operations Squadron director of MAFR, July 15, 2019. Slife and Olson toured the range and facilities utilized by Air Commandos. Before the tour, Slife and Olson met with local and state leaders.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Vernon R. Walter III)
